999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

基于SVG的電力系統的自動布圖

2016-02-22 08:38:23李璞玉
科技視界 2016年4期

李璞玉

【摘 要】可縮放矢量圖形(Scalable Vector Graphics, SVG)作為一種開放標準的文本式矢量圖形描述語言,是目前電力系統圖形領域通用的設計方案。本文從電力圖元的數據模型出發,進行SVG/CIM建模,分析其拓撲關系并導入規范文件測試,導出完整的SVG圖形文件,最終實現電力圖元的自動布圖,驗證其算法的正確性與通用性。

【關鍵詞】SVG;CIM;自動布圖算法

Automatic Layout of the Power System Based on SVG

LI Pu-yu

(College of Automation, Chongqing University of Posts and Telecommunications, Chongqing 400065, China)

【Abstract】Scalable Vector Graphics(SVG) as a kind of open standard text Vector graphic description language. It is a common design scheme of the power graphics system. Based on electric power of primitive data model, build SVG/CIM model, analysis of the relationship between the topology and imports formal file graphics on test system, exports the complete SVG graphics file, finally realizes the primitive power automatic layout, and verifies the validity and generality of this algorithm.

【Key words】SVG; CIM; Automatic layout algorithm

1 SVG概述

SVG是一種基于 XML 的文本式矢量圖形描述語言,符合IEC61970標準中對數據交互的要求,且SVG具有文件尺寸小、任意縮放、動畫、超強顯示和適合網絡傳輸等優點[1]。因此,采用SVG作為電力圖形的存儲格式,實現了圖形格式的統一,解決了電力格式的位圖圖像在數據Web發布的問題。

2 SVG/CIM模型

CIM是一個抽象模型,它描述了電力企業中的主要對象,定義了信息交換內容的語義。CIM使用統一建模語言UML,將CIM定義為一組包[2]。CIM中的每一個包包含一個或多個類圖,用圖形表示包中的所有類及類間的關系,然后根據類的屬性及與其它類的關系,用文字形式定義每個類。

電力系統中的圖形包含著具體的電氣含義,這些電氣屬性在CIM/XML文件中描述。所以,必須結合CIM/XML文件才能實現完整的圖形信息的交互。電力系統中的圖形界面由大量的圖元構成,每個圖元都有自己特定的功能,代表特定的含義,并具有高度封裝性。為了和CIM進行關聯,對于每一類對象都需要描述一個id,這樣就可以將CIM的對象和SVG的對象關聯起來[3]。

電力系統中涉及大量的電氣元件,CIM模型對其進行了規范化的描述[4]。SVG圖元按照CIM模型描述的電氣對象模型設計,SVG圖元類必須描述設備類的所有屬性。SVG/CIM模型,對象存在繼承、簡單關聯和聚集三種關系。

3 自動布圖

拓撲結構是潮流分析、狀態估計等高級應用的基礎[5]。根據連接節點關聯端點的數量分為:簡單節點和復合節點。簡單節點指所有的連接節點都只關聯2個端點。復合節點指存在一個連接節點關聯2個以上端點。

3.1 自動布圖算法

為了防止在布圖的過程中端點所對應分支上的圖形發生重疊,所以每個分支在布圖之前需要判斷該節點關聯端點的索引。布圖的前提是確定起點位置和母線的數量,具體如下:

①不包含母線時以連接節點為布圖的起點;②包含母線時以母線為布圖的起點,分別遍歷關聯端點。面對簡單節點時任取其中一個連接節點為起點;面對復合節點:包含一個復合節點時,以該復合節點為起點;包含多個復合節點時,以關聯端點數量最多的復合節點為起點。如果該端點所對應的分支與第二條母線相連或者屬于接地分支,則向下布圖;否則均向上布圖。除了最后一條母線外,所有母線的遍歷規則都和第一條母線相同,最后一條母線除了和其它母線相連的分支外,均向下布圖。

3.2 自動布圖算法測試

圖1 電力圖形系統測試結果

圖形系統測試采用規范的CIM/XML文件:ABB公司的ABB_40.9b.xml。如圖1所示,導出標準的SVG文件。電力圖元來自CIM/XML文件中的設備模型,通過唯一的id實現與CIM/XML文件中設備模型對應,證明基于SVG的電力系統的自動布圖的正確性和通用性。

4 結論

將SVG技術應用與電力圖形系統,可供Web調用或第三方應用軟件使用,有利于不同開發商的EMS系統的信息交換。SVG/CIM建模為自動布圖的順利進行奠定了基礎,整個布圖算法從母線的數量出發,分別設計其電力圖元布局方式,實現了將源系統私有圖形格式轉換成標準的SVG圖形格式,從而驗證電力圖形系統的自動布圖。

【參考文獻】

[1]黃凱偉.SVG開發實踐[M].北京:機械工業出版社,2008.

[2]周博曦,孟昭勇,王志臣,等.基于CIM的變電站與配電饋線一次接線圖自動繪制算法[J].電力系統自動化,2012,36(11):77-80.

[3]李慧娟,董成明,秦志沁,等.基于SVG的電力系統圖形中動態圖元技術研究[J].山西科技,2013,28(2):115-117.

[4]紀陵,蔣衍君,施廣德,等.基于SVG的電力系統圖形互操作研究[J].電力自動化設備,2011,31(7):105-109.

[5]張自聰.基于CIM/SVG的省級電網均勻圖的自動生成[D].杭州:杭州電子科技大學,2009.

[責任編輯:王楠]

主站蜘蛛池模板: 国产在线91在线电影| 天天做天天爱夜夜爽毛片毛片| 四虎永久在线精品影院| 亚洲视频影院| 国产97视频在线观看| 国产又大又粗又猛又爽的视频| 精品视频一区二区观看| 亚洲国产精品不卡在线 | 国产精品成人观看视频国产| 色综合久久88色综合天天提莫| 97青草最新免费精品视频| www精品久久| 日本一区二区不卡视频| 麻豆精品视频在线原创| 四虎成人在线视频| 国产美女精品在线| 人妻精品久久无码区| 国产欧美又粗又猛又爽老| 熟妇人妻无乱码中文字幕真矢织江 | 亚洲国产日韩在线观看| 国产爽爽视频| 欧美区一区二区三| 九色在线观看视频| 国产亚洲精品97在线观看| 日韩在线成年视频人网站观看| 亚洲第一精品福利| 伊人福利视频| 全部免费特黄特色大片视频| 国产91在线|日本| 91毛片网| A级毛片无码久久精品免费| 激情综合激情| 69av在线| 亚洲无线一二三四区男男| 久久久久久久久18禁秘 | 国产亚洲日韩av在线| 欧美日韩午夜| 视频二区国产精品职场同事| 久久久成年黄色视频| 精品国产美女福到在线直播| 亚洲av无码牛牛影视在线二区| 激情乱人伦| 91网红精品在线观看| 日本一区二区三区精品视频| 国产网友愉拍精品视频| 久久综合结合久久狠狠狠97色| 任我操在线视频| 狠狠做深爱婷婷久久一区| 综合人妻久久一区二区精品 | 福利在线不卡一区| 亚洲国产精品成人久久综合影院| 国产 在线视频无码| 真实国产乱子伦高清| 成人免费视频一区| 亚洲婷婷六月| 午夜福利无码一区二区| 国产成人一区免费观看| 久久网欧美| 少妇被粗大的猛烈进出免费视频| 久久国产精品电影| 青青草原国产免费av观看| 青青国产成人免费精品视频| 精品无码一区二区三区电影| 嫩草影院在线观看精品视频| 日韩av无码精品专区| 2021国产在线视频| 亚洲天堂网在线视频| 亚洲AV无码久久天堂| 午夜影院a级片| 亚洲国产成人精品无码区性色| 制服丝袜国产精品| 欧美精品三级在线| 国产18在线播放| 永久免费av网站可以直接看的| 国产粉嫩粉嫩的18在线播放91| 国产高清免费午夜在线视频| 精品国产网| 婷婷色丁香综合激情| 8090成人午夜精品| 在线国产综合一区二区三区 | 国产亚洲精品yxsp| 国产精品护士|